9: /*
10: ** READADMIN -- read admin file into 'Admin' cache
11: **
12: ** The admin file in the current directory is opened and read
13: ** into the 'Admin' cache. The admin file contains the following
14: ** information:
15: **
16: ** A header block, containing the owner of the database (that is,
17: ** the DBA), and a set of status bits for the database as a whole.
18: ** These bits are defined in aux.h. This header also includes a
19: ** field that defines the length of the header part & a version
20: ** stamp.
21: **
22: ** Descriptors for the relation and attribute relations. These
23: ** descriptors should be completely correct except for the
24: ** relfp and relopn fields. These are required so that the
25: ** process of opening a relation is not recursive.
26: **
27: ** After the admin file is read in, the relation and attribute
28: ** files are opened, and the relfp and relopn fields in both
29: ** descriptors are correctly initialized. Both catalogs are
30: ** opened read/write.
31: **
32: ** WARNING:
33: ** This routine is redefined by creatdb. If this
34: ** routine is changed, check that program also!!
35: **
36: ** Parameters:
37: ** none
38: **
39: ** Returns:
40: ** none
41: **
42: ** Side Effects:
43: ** The 'Admin' struct is filled in from the 'admin' file
44: ** in the current directory.
45: ** The 'relation....xx' and 'attribute...xx' files are
46: ** opened.
47: **
48: ** Files:
49: ** ./admin
50: ** The bootstrap description of the database,
51: ** described above.
52: **
53: ** Trace Flags:
54: ** none
55: */
